Why we exist

When paid performance drops, the media buyer says the creative is fatigued and the creative supplier says the targeting is wrong. Both are usually right, which is exactly why nothing gets fixed.

The industry has words for this. “Creative fatigue” and “post-click drop-off” are both seam failures, described as if they were weather. They are not weather. They are what happens when three suppliers each own a piece and none owns the number.

We removed the seam by running the whole loop ourselves — the creative, the media that distributes it, and the destination it lands on — with a named specialist accountable for each part.
